Uses of Class
com.alee.managers.plugin.data.DetectedPlugin

Packages that use DetectedPlugin
com.alee.managers.plugin   
 

Uses of DetectedPlugin in com.alee.managers.plugin
 

Fields in com.alee.managers.plugin declared as DetectedPlugin
protected  DetectedPlugin<T> Plugin.detectedPlugin
          Detected plugin information.
 

Fields in com.alee.managers.plugin with type parameters of type DetectedPlugin
protected  java.util.List<DetectedPlugin<T>> PluginManager.detectedPlugins
          Detected plugins list.
protected  Filter<DetectedPlugin<T>> PluginManager.pluginFilter
          Special filter to filter out unwanted plugins before their initialization.
protected  java.util.List<DetectedPlugin<T>> PluginManager.recentlyDetected
          Recently detected plugins list.
 

Methods in com.alee.managers.plugin that return DetectedPlugin
 DetectedPlugin<T> Plugin.getDetectedPlugin()
          Returns additional information about this plugin.
 

Methods in com.alee.managers.plugin that return types with arguments of type DetectedPlugin
 java.util.List<DetectedPlugin<T>> PluginManager.getDetectedPlugins()
          Returns list of detected plugins.
 Filter<DetectedPlugin<T>> PluginManager.getPluginFilter()
          Returns special filter that filters out unwanted plugins before their initialization.
 

Methods in com.alee.managers.plugin with parameters of type DetectedPlugin
 boolean PluginManager.isDeprecatedVersion(DetectedPlugin<T> plugin)
          Returns whether the list of detected plugins contain a newer version of the specified plugin or not.
 boolean PluginManager.isDeprecatedVersion(DetectedPlugin<T> plugin, java.util.List<DetectedPlugin<T>> detectedPlugins)
          Returns whether the list of detected plugins contain a newer version of the specified plugin or not.
protected  boolean PluginManager.isSameVersionAlreadyLoaded(DetectedPlugin<T> plugin, java.util.List<DetectedPlugin<T>> detectedPlugins)
          Returns whether the list of detected plugins contain the same version of the specified plugin or not.
protected  void Plugin.setDetectedPlugin(DetectedPlugin<T> detectedPlugin)
          Sets additional information about this plugin.
 

Method parameters in com.alee.managers.plugin with type arguments of type DetectedPlugin
 void PluginManager.firePluginsDetected(java.util.List<DetectedPlugin<T>> plugins)
          Informs about newly detected plugins.
 boolean PluginManager.isDeprecatedVersion(DetectedPlugin<T> plugin, java.util.List<DetectedPlugin<T>> detectedPlugins)
          Returns whether the list of detected plugins contain a newer version of the specified plugin or not.
protected  boolean PluginManager.isSameVersionAlreadyLoaded(DetectedPlugin<T> plugin, java.util.List<DetectedPlugin<T>> detectedPlugins)
          Returns whether the list of detected plugins contain the same version of the specified plugin or not.
 void PluginsListener.pluginsDetected(java.util.List<DetectedPlugin<T>> plugins)
          Called when new portion of plugins have been detected.
 void PluginsAdapter.pluginsDetected(java.util.List<DetectedPlugin<T>> plugins)
          Called when new portion of plugins have been detected.
 void PluginManager.setPluginFilter(Filter<DetectedPlugin<T>> pluginFilter)
          Sets special filter that filters out unwanted plugins before their initialization.